Byzantine Gold Earring with Cross and Garnet

CIRCA 8TH-10TH CENTURY A.D.

1 3/4 in. (6.53 grams, 44 mm).

Penannular hoop with applied collars, applied discoid plaque with beaded rum and openwork cross to the centre, lateral granule clusters, facetted garnet bead below.

Provenance

Acquired in the mid 1980s-1990s.
Private collection, Switzerland, thence by descent.
Private collection, since the late 1990s.
